The LIU project will be broken into 3 separate but related areas concerned with MPEG-4 Facial Animation.
The research will expand upon the work done by
John Stallo in his honours on adding emotion to speech,
and by Quoc Huynh in his honours work on Facial Expressions and will
expand upon and validate the
Virtual Human Markup Language (VHML). The work will result in a large scale
demonstration (see later).
The research will involve
- literature review: the 3 students to each investigate one of the first 3 areas and that area's relevance
to the last area - Talking Heads.
- The effect of Emotion on Speech, and Speech Utterances
- The effect of Emotion on Facial Expression, and Facial gestures
- The use of XML as a markup language for controlling Virtual Actors.
- The use and applications of Talking Heads. See later Case Study Demonstration and
Evaluation.
- inspection verification: the 3 students to each identify, verify and correct the implemented VHML tags in
one of the first 3 areas and all to formulate a long term strategy for the development of the last area. This
will result in a small XML based C/C++/Java application to manage "stimulus-reponse" Dialogue Manager databases.
Students to seek expert advice from partners in the InterFace project via email interviews.
- Text to Speech markup - SML
- Facial Animation markup - FAML
- Emotion markup - EML
- Dialogue Manager markup - DMML
- Case Study Demonstration and Evaluation of the HCI issues arising
from a Talking Head being used to deliver information in response to user enquiries.
The above tasks allow for separate investigation by students with flexibility of choice
(the first 3 areas in lists above) but drive the
investigation to a single goal with a common thread (the last area).

- New: The demonstration design. A significant design and implementation case study that will
incorporate all the above research areas to highlight the functionality and versatility of the
system.
The demonstration will consist of two experiments :
- A story teller(probably of a childrens story) - this will demonstrate the emotional capability of the
Talking Head and demonstrate the power of VHML. It is envisaged that multiple heads could be used with
different voices. The story will be interactive in a trivial way in that the listener can direct where the
story may go at certain branch points through a question-answer mechanism.
- An information provider for enquiries about Talking Head Technology. The system will demonstrate the
Dialogue Manager functionality of the Talking Head and its believability as a humane interface to information.
The demonstration will also test the suitability of different head types to convey information and how well
different personalities convey information.
